Evolutionary Trends in Welding Automation

The global welding landscape is undergoing a seismic shift. The convergence of Artificial Intelligence (AI) and traditional robotics has redefined "welding tasks." No longer limited to repetitive MIG/TIG paths, modern automation now encompasses:

AI Visual Positioning

Integrating 3D vision systems allows robots to detect seam variances in real-time, adjusting the torch path dynamically. This reduces rejection rates by up to 45% compared to blind-programming.

Collaborative Cobots

The rise of Cobots (Collaborative Robots) like our Gd20 series enables humans and robots to work side-by-side without safety cages, ideal for flexible, small-batch production environments.

Green Manufacturing

Automated systems optimize power consumption and wire usage, contributing to ESG goals and reducing environmental footprints in metal fabrication.

Localized Application Scenarios

Our automated systems are designed for diverse, high-stakes environments:

  • Automotive Manufacturing: High-speed spot welding and MIG welding for sheet metal with IP54-rated protection for harsh conditions.
  • Shipbuilding & Heavy Equipment: Massive manipulators and crane-integrated robots for welding thick-walled steel beams and hulls.
  • Aerospace Components: High-precision TIG robotic stations where thermal management and micro-millimeter accuracy are non-negotiable.
  • Construction Machinery: Multi-axis coordination for welding complex 3D structures in excavator frames and cranes.
